West Bengal CID investigates suicides with suspected links to 'Momo Challenge', says most people received 'fake' invitations to play game
The Momo Challenge has reportedly claimed two lives so far. In the game, players were “challenged” to communicate with an unknown number. Once the initial contact with a user is established, the Momo account sends a number of challenged and activities that are to be completed to meet ‘Momo’. It allegedly involves challenges that encourage children to engage in a series of violent acts that end with suicide.
